Thomas Koeller had reported an issue where a device that had been making use
of the UART_BUG_TXEN code in the 8250 driver was mistakenly being caught by
the backup timer test, causing the device to work improperly.
To fix this, tighten the test requirements to enable the backup timer
workaround.
The backup timer is really meant to catch UARTs that don't re-assert the THRE
interrupt. The expectation is that they do initially assert THRE. This patch
clarifies the test.

The Xilinx 16550 uart core is not a standard 16550 because it uses
word-based addressing rather than byte-based addressing. With
additional properties it is compatible with the open firmware
'ns16550' compatible binding.
This code updates the of_serial driver to handle the reg-offset
and reg-shift properties to enable this core to be used.

Do not use the URXD_CHARRDY bit for polling for new characters. This works
on i.MX1, but on MX31 the datasheet states that this bit should not be
used for polling. On MX27 it is even worse, here we get a bus error when
we access the read FIFO when no character is present.
Instead, use USR2_RDR (receive data ready) bit.

This patch allocates parameter RAM for SMC serial ports without relying on
previous initialisation by a boot loader or a wrapper layer.
SMC parameter RAM on CPM2-based platforms can be allocated anywhere in the
general-purpose areas of the dual-port RAM. The current code relies on the
boot loader to allocate a section of general-purpose CPM RAM and gets the
section address from the device tree.
This patch modifies the device tree address usage to reference the SMC
parameter RAM base pointer instead of a pre-allocated RAM section and
allocates memory from the CPM dual-port RAM when initialising the SMC port.
CPM1-based platforms are not affected.

The of_serial driver queries the current-speed property and attempts
to use it to register the custom_divisor property of the uart_port.
However, if current-speed is not set, then this code will dereference
a bad pointer. The fix is to only set custom_divisor when a
current-speed property appears in the device tree.

Strange chars appear on the serial port when a printk and a printf
happens at the same time. This is caused by the pdc sending chars while
atmel_console_write (called from printk) is executing
Concurent access of uart and console to the same port leads to corrupted
data to be transmitted, so disable tx dma (PDC) while writing to the
console.
